When driving on the road, communicating to vehicles behind you is made possible through your Ford Explorer's tail light. It's a type of signal light which indicates whether you're turning left, right, and even when you're stepping on the brakes. This way, you're assured that the driver behind you gets informed of your intended actions, such as slowing down or stopping completely, so as to avoid rear-end collisions and other accidents. If your Ford Explorer tail light breaks or fades, it will be difficult to signal your movements to others. Therefore, it's a must that you keep your tail lights in an optimum working condition.
